วิธีแก้ปัญหากด Override Template Joomla (โอเวอร์ไรด์ เทมเพลต จูมล่า)แล้วเจอโฟเดอร์ว่างเปล่า

แชร์ ความรู้ในการ พัฒนา Joomla Component Extension Module Plugin

Moderators: mindphp, ผู้ดูแลกระดาน

User avatar
pond
PHP Super Hero Member
PHP Super Hero Member
Posts: 570
Joined: 25/05/2016 9:44 am

วิธีแก้ปัญหากด Override Template Joomla (โอเวอร์ไรด์ เทมเพลต จูมล่า)แล้วเจอโฟเดอร์ว่างเปล่า

Post by pond » 05/07/2016 5:14 pm

โดยปกติแล้วการกด Override Template Joomla (โอเวอร์ไรด์ เทมเพลต จูมล่า)นั้น ตัวJoomlaจะสร้างไฟล์ให้เราที่ชื่อว่า defult.php ขึ้นมาให้เราทำการแก้ไขได้แต่ในบางกรณี Module(โมดูล) หรือว่า Component(คอมโพแนนท์) นั้นไม่ได้สร้างมาแบบที่ตัว Joomla ได้กำหนดเอาไว้ส่งผลให้ ตัวเว็บไซต์ Jooomla นั้นไม่สามารถทำการ Copy ไฟล์ที่ต้องการจะ Override ได้นั่นเอง วันนนี้ผมจะมาสอนวิธีการCopy ไฟล์ที่ต้องการจะ Override เองโดยที่ไม่ผ่านตัว Joomla
gg11.png
gg11.png (52.25 KiB) Viewed 1885 times
ขั้นแรกเลยให้ไปที่โฟเดอร์ที่ เก็บ Component หรือว่า Module ตัวที่ท่านต้องการจะ Override
gg2.png
gg2.png (60.66 KiB) Viewed 1885 times
กดเข้ามาแล้วก็ทำการกดไปที่โฟลเดอร์ที่จะต้องการจะ Override
gg33.png
gg33.png (91.13 KiB) Viewed 1885 times
ให้กดไปที่โฟลเดอร์ tmpl
gg44.png
gg44.png (13.28 KiB) Viewed 1885 times
พอเข้ามาก็จะเจอไฟล์ที่ชื่อว่า defult ให้เราทำการ Copy ไปวางไว้ในโฟเดอร์ html ยัง Template ของเรา โดยให้เราสร้างโฟเดอร์ที่มีชื่อเหมือนกันกับโฟลเดอร์Module หรือ Component ที่เราไปทำการ copy มาวางไฟล์ defult ลงไป
ggend.png
ggend.png (9.5 KiB) Viewed 1885 times
เพียงเท่านี้ก็จะสามารถไฟล์ Override ได้เองแล้ว



Post Reply

Return to “Joomla Developing Knowledge”

Users browsing this forum: No registered users and 2 guests